Key Facts

  • Ohio-class submarine's instance of is recorded as submarine class[3].
  • Ohio-class submarine is operated by United States Navy[4].
  • USS Ohio is named after Ohio-class submarine[5].
  • Ohio-class submarine's manufacturer is recorded as General Dynamics Electric Boat[6].
  • Ohio-class submarine is a type of ballistic missile submarine[7].
  • Ohio-class submarine's designed by is recorded as General Dynamics Electric Boat[8].
  • Ohio-class submarine's Commons category is recorded as Ohio class submarines[9].
  • Ohio-class submarine's country of origin is recorded as United States[10].
  • 1979 marks the founding of Ohio-class submarine[11].
  • Ohio-class submarine's topic's main category is recorded as Category:Ohio-class submarines[12].
  • Ohio-class submarine's replaced by is recorded as Columbia-class submarine[13].
